As Regional Director, you'll lead our Companion Animal practice teams across Buckinghamshire, providing strategic direction, coaching, and operational support. You'll be the driving force behind practice leaders' development—enabling them to inspire their team to deliver clinical excellence, team wellbeing, and business performance.

How do you contribute to this:

Responsibilities
  • Lead regional growth, client service delivery, and operational excellence.
  • Act as a key stakeholder with other areas of the business to deliver client, people and clinical improvements/initiatives.
  • Drive clinical development initiatives aligned with client needs and national strategy.
  • Own regional budget delivery and support practice-level P&L accountability.
  • Champion consistent customer service and clinical training across practices.
  • Analyse performance metrics to drive top-line sales and EBITDA growth.
  • Ensure compliance with health & safety, RCVS, VMD, and legal obligations.
  • Lead regional implementation of new technologies and clinical improvement projects.
  • Oversee talent development, succession planning, and colleague utilisation.
  • Promote psychological safety and a culture of learning and inclusivity.
  • Oversee recruitment, onboarding, absence, and retention processes regionally.
  • Support property investment, acquisitions, and facility development.
  • Facilitate cross-functional collaboration and strategic alignment.
  • Role model CVS values: empathy, accountability, inclusivity, and collaboration.

This is a field-based role with some opportunity to work from home. There will be regular travel across your region and occasional national travel for CVS events, conferences, and leadership forums.
